Job Description

full-time
Our client is seeking a highly experienced and motivated Principal Mining Geologist to join their globally distributed team. This is a fully remote position, offering the flexibility to work from anywhere while contributing to critical exploration and resource estimation projects. You will be responsible for leading geological interpretations, defining mineral resources, and providing expert advice on geological models for various mining operations. The role requires a deep understanding of geological principles, advanced modeling techniques, and a strong track record in resource estimation and exploration geology. You will play a key role in the strategic planning of exploration programs, data acquisition, and the generation of high-quality geological reports. The ideal candidate will possess excellent analytical skills, proficiency in geological software, and the ability to interpret complex geological data. Collaboration with geologists, engineers, and management across different time zones will be essential, necessitating strong communication and remote teamwork skills. This position demands a proactive approach to problem-solving and a commitment to maintaining the highest standards of geological practice.
Key Responsibilities:
  • Lead geological interpretation and 3D modeling for mineral resource estimation.
  • Design and oversee geological exploration programs.
  • Conduct data acquisition, quality control, and validation.
  • Prepare detailed geological reports, including resource and reserve statements.
  • Provide expert geological advice and technical support to project teams and management.
  • Mentor and guide junior geologists and technical staff.
  • Ensure compliance with industry standards (e.g., JORC, NI 43-101).
  • Stay updated on the latest geological technologies and methodologies.
  • Contribute to the strategic direction of exploration and resource development projects.
Required Qualifications:
  • Master's degree or PhD in Geology, Economic Geology, or a related field.
  • Minimum of 10 years of experience in mining geology, exploration, and resource estimation.
  • Proven expertise in 3D geological modeling software (e.g., Leapfrog, Micromine, Datamine).
  • Demonstrated experience in resource and reserve reporting according to international standards.
  • Strong understanding of mineral deposit types and geological controls.
  • Excellent analytical, problem-solving, and critical thinking skills.
  • Proficiency in statistical analysis and geostatistics.
  • Exceptional written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to present complex information clearly.
  • Experience working effectively in a remote, international team environment.
